I think you'll find that it was "incidental music" written for the show (probably by Peter Davis, John Mealing and/or John G. Perry (as per "Music" in the credits)). One of the few "commercial songs" ever heard in PG (and I'd love to hear of any others people have picked) is "Smash It Up" by The Damned - which Colin is watching the music vid of while thinking of Cindy. I became sl. obsessed with that song after hearing it on the show - buying the Batman Forever Soundtrack to get a copy of The Offspring doing a copy of it, until I saw the original clip on Rage (Aussie music video show which runs through the night on Fridays and Saturdays) and realised it was done by the Damned - since thjen I have bought the Damned's "Best Of" album, which also contains that song (and which I can recommend, if only for "Smash It Up" and a very different version of the old hippie-era song "Ask Alice"). The clip still gets played on Rage relatively frequently for it's age (it's on at least once every month or so).
